AD7836 TERMINOLOGY Relative Accuracy Relative accuracy or endpoint linearity is a measure of the max- imum deviation from a straight line passing through the endpoints of the DAC transfer function measured after adjusting for zero error and full-scale ...

Power-On with CLR Low The output stage of the AD7836 has been designed to allow output stability during power-on. If CLR is kept low during power-on, then just after power is applied to the AD7836, the situation is as depicted ...

Automated Test Equipment The AD7836 is particularly suited for use in an automated test environment. Figure 21 shows the AD7836 providing the nec- essary voltages for the pin driver and the window comparator in a typical ATE pin electronics configuration. ...
